About this work
Strip of natural-colored bobbin lace: collar lace. Pattern with four rows of diamonds and a row of triangles along the straight upper edge. Shell edge with pointed shells formed by the lower row of diamonds. The row of triangles at the top and the middle row of diamonds are made with a strop net ground in which four diamonds are in linen stitch (middle row) or a V-shaped motif in net stitch (in the triangles). The other diamonds are made in net stitch with a diamond in linen stitch in the center. The diamonds forming the shell edge have diagonal lines.
